Why Communication Matters at a Family Law Office
July 31, 2026

July 31, 2026

Family law matters often involve significant personal, financial, and legal considerations that can affect individuals and families for years to come. Whether someone is navigating divorce, child custody, adoption, or another family-related legal issue, clear communication is one of the most important elements of effective legal representation. Understanding legal rights, court procedures, and available options allows clients to make informed decisions during challenging situations. Throughout every stage of a case, consistent communication helps build a productive attorney-client relationship and supports better preparation.


Legal experience is certainly important, but communication is what allows that experience to benefit each client effectively. Attorneys who explain legal processes clearly, provide timely updates, and listen carefully to client concerns create an environment where informed decisions become easier to make. A professional family law office recognizes that every client's circumstances are unique and that thoughtful communication plays a central role in developing appropriate legal strategies. By maintaining open dialogue throughout the legal process, attorneys help clients move forward with greater confidence.


Establishing Clear Expectations


One of the first responsibilities of a professional family law office is helping clients understand what to expect throughout their legal matter. During an initial consultation, attorneys gather information about the client's circumstances while explaining how the legal process may apply to the case. Setting realistic expectations early helps reduce uncertainty and allows clients to prepare for upcoming decisions. This foundation supports productive communication throughout the representation.


Clear expectations also help clients understand the timeline, documentation, and procedural requirements associated with their case. Every family law matter follows its own path depending on the facts involved, making personalized guidance especially valuable. Attorneys explain available options while helping clients recognize both opportunities and potential challenges. This approach allows individuals to participate more confidently in important legal decisions.


Explaining Legal Procedures


Many family law cases involve legal terminology and court procedures that may be unfamiliar to clients. A professional family law office takes time to explain these processes using clear, understandable language rather than assuming prior legal knowledge. Helping clients understand each stage of their case reduces confusion while encouraging informed participation throughout the legal process. Effective explanations allow clients to better understand what lies ahead.


Legal procedures often involve multiple filings, deadlines, hearings, and negotiations that require careful coordination. Attorneys keep clients informed about upcoming milestones while explaining how each step contributes to the overall case strategy. Consistent communication allows clients to remain engaged and prepared throughout the process. Understanding the legal system helps reduce unnecessary stress during complex family matters.

Providing Timely Updates


Keeping clients informed throughout their case is an important part of effective legal representation. A professional family law office communicates significant developments, court dates, filings, negotiations, and other important information as the case moves forward. Regular updates help clients understand where their case stands and what to expect next. Consistent communication reduces uncertainty during what can often be an emotional process.


According to IBISWorld, the family law and divorce lawyers industry in the United States includes approximately 56,771 businesses. With so many legal practices serving clients nationwide, responsive communication continues to distinguish firms that prioritize keeping clients informed throughout every stage of representation. Ongoing updates strengthen the attorney-client relationship while supporting better decision-making.
